I built the 1st Jag V12 engined Land Rover way back in the 90's, that used the Jag auto box connected to a series 3 Land Rover transfer box giving normal 2wd on the road and it was modified to allow changing into 4wd at up to 50mph and back into 2wd while still on the move. it was built on a modified Range Rover chassis and looked standard from the outside, made a great Q car for the traffic light Grand Prix, surprised more than a few hot hatch cars.
